Double Glazing prices in Poole 2026
We've compiled current installed price ranges for double glazing in the Dorset area. Actual costs depend on window size and specification — compare quotes for a precise figure.
| Window Type | From (installed) | Up to (installed) |
|---|---|---|
| Casement (single) | £350 | £700 |
| Casement (large) | £500 | £900 |
| Sash Window | £600 | £1,100 |
| Bay Window (3-panel) | £1,200 | £3,200 |
| Tilt & Turn | £400 | £750 |
* Prices are estimates for Poole based on current market data. Your exact quote will depend on window size, specification and chosen installer.

How much does double glazing cost in Poole?
Installed double glazing costs in Poole start from around £350 per window and can reach £3,200 for larger bay units. Dorset prices are in line with the national average. Getting multiple quotes through our free service is the most reliable way to establish an exact budget.
How long does window installation take in Poole?
The time required depends on how many windows are being installed. In Poole, a single window can be replaced in 2–4 hours, while a whole-house installation typically takes 2–3 days. Your installer will confirm the schedule during their free property survey.

Can I replace my windows in Poole without planning consent?
For the majority of Poole properties, window replacement is classed as permitted development and does not need planning permission. Exceptions apply if your home is in a Dorset conservation area or is a listed building, in which case local authority consent may be required.
